**Fire at Farmakas Quarry Investigated by Police**
Farmakas, Cyprus – A fire erupted in an excavator at a quarry located in Farmakas on Thursday evening, prompting an investigation by local police. The incident occurred around 7 PM when the fire ignited at the front of the parked excavator, causing significant damage to the machinery.
According to police reports, the blaze was first noticed by workers at the quarry, who quickly took action to extinguish the flames before they could spread further. Their prompt response likely mitigated additional damage and potential hazards associated with the fire.
Following the initial efforts by the workers, both the police and the fire service were alerted to the situation. Upon their arrival, fire service personnel worked to bring the fire under control, ensuring that the situation did not escalate.
The cause of the fire remains under investigation as authorities work to determine the circumstances surrounding the incident. No injuries have been reported, and the focus remains on assessing the damage to the excavator and the quarry site.
